Output 2e1b2ed6d6658ffd7d087d35a5be9e8879904aee5f68dbd7e76ebd1a84b53bef:0

value
420988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ab18d14a249f0422142c04c656071f24744708 OP_EQUAL
address
3QMrU9B5Zg42tRRPBguScfuepdtQ9Q57kM
transaction
2e1b2ed6d6658ffd7d087d35a5be9e8879904aee5f68dbd7e76ebd1a84b53bef
confirmations
149488
spent
true